The first very large ethane carrier (VLEC) has been exported from Energy Transfer LP’s (ET) Nederland Terminal in East Texas loaded with more than 911,000 bbl of ethane destined for northeastern Jiangsu Province, China.

Dallas-based ET said the VLEC was loaded by Orbit Gulf Coast NGL Exports LLC, its joint venture with Satellite Petrochemical USA Corp. The Seri Everest, the world’s largest VLEC according to ET, departed from Orbit’s newly constructed export facilities at ET’s Nederland Terminal southeast of Houston near Port Arthur on Sunday (Jan. 17). The vessel was destined for Satellite’s Lianyungang ethane cracker in China’s northeastern Jiangsu Province, with an expected arrival at Lianyungang Port in mid-February.
